The council voted unanimously Feb. 2 to adopt Ordinance 2026-001 annexing a 158-acre property owned by Adelman Farm LLC in Eureka Township under Minn. Stat. §414.033; the ordinance includes a two-year reimbursement schedule to the township.
The Farmington City Council on Feb. 2 adopted Ordinance 2026-001 to annex a 158-acre property in Eureka Township owned by Adelman Farm LLC.
